Blackpool are looking to again make a move for Plymouth Argyle winger Bradley Wright-Phillips.
The 25-year old has taken League One by storm this season, scoring 13 times in 17 appearances, and Seasiders boss Ian Holloway feels the club should enquire again for his services.
Wright-Phillips was close to a move to Championship club Reading recently but Holloway says that perhaps Blackpool should reignite their pursuit after their initial attempt did not go to plan.
"Maybe we can pick it up again," Holloway said. "(Chairman) Karl (Oyston) sent his agent an email and he showed it to the player who didn't feel wanted. It didn't look like we wanted him that much."
